The Origins of Valentine's Day

Valentine's Day, celebrated annually on February 14th, is a day dedicated to love and affection. Its origins are a tapestry woven from ancient traditions, religious customs, and historical events. Unlike many holidays with clear and well-documented beginnings, the story of Valentine's Day is shrouded in mystery and legend.

St. Valentine: The Man Behind the Day

The most widely accepted origin of Valentine's Day traces back to St. Valentine, but even here, the waters are murky. According to the Catholic Church, there were at least three different saints named Valentine or Valentinus, all martyred. One popular legend posits that Valentine was a priest in third-century Rome. When Emperor Claudius II decided that single men made better soldiers than those with wives and families, he outlawed marriage for young men. Valentine, realizing the injustice, defied Claudius and continued to perform marriages for young lovers in secret. When his actions were discovered, Claudius ordered that Valentine be put to death.
